Sherzod Asadov, Uzbek president’s press secretary, informed about the work schedule of the president this week, Daryo correspondent reports.
"On October 11, the head of state will receive the head of the Republic of Tatarstan, Rustam Minnikhanov to discuss the issues of further development of interregional cooperation with new content and specific projects, as well as the further acceleration of the ongoing joint programs of cooperation," Asadov started.
On October 12-14, President Mirziyoyev will visit Kazakhstan to participate at the Conference on Interaction and Confidence Building Measures in Asia (CICA) before joining the meeting of the Council of Heads of State of the Commonwealth of the Independent States, and the "Central Asia - Russia" summit.
The agenda of the visit includes holding bilateral meetings with foreign countries, including Vice President of the Socialist Republic of Vietnam Vo Thi Anh Suan, Prime Minister of the Islamic Republic of Pakistan Shahbaz Sharif and heads of a number of international organizations.
